I love language, Introductory flight, Air experience flight (what's the difference?), Trial lesson.
So a Introductory flight is one where you trust the reputation of your company to use a PPL to fly a stranger and hope they might come back and learn.
Air experience, much the same thing but perhaps a term nicked from the RAF when cadets were taken up for ten minute ride and shown some basic aeros to try engendered some interest to join the air force, and fill a sick bag.
And Trial lesson, advertise a one hour lesson and only fly 20 minutes, to look competitive to the school down the road that gives a full hours flying, for twice the price and of course pay the instructor for the 20 minute flight.
